Output 588292b09071b53afddbb8321c3c6395411c8c43700cc6ba8ab1b57d97127a04:0

value
12128032
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 23b237aa68df00bdd6e3be62a6b6f68c366a05f5 OP_EQUALVERIFY OP_CHECKSIG
address
14Fk9UntTaXpFYmVkjPDtSq7gdEDESNSkb
transaction
588292b09071b53afddbb8321c3c6395411c8c43700cc6ba8ab1b57d97127a04
confirmations
516626
spent
true